Quick Search Engine Tips

Search Engine Optimization (SEO) is the art of tailoring a website so that it will rank high in search engines for a certain set of search terms, commonly known as keywords. It is an elaborate and detailed skill, that can only be developed over time. However, for business owners that have just recently started a website, here are a few quick tips for getting off to a good start:

  1. Describe your business concisely - write up a 25 word description of your business, that really nails what you do and what your company is all about. This can be used by search engines as a teaser to drive vistors to your site.
  2. Identify Keywords - determine what words potential visitors will use to find your business in search engines. Strive to create rich content on your site that uses these words appropriately, helping to increase your search engine rank for these terms.
  3. Get Listed - submit your URL and site description to the major search engines (Yahoo, Google, MSN, AOL, Altavista), and especially DMOZ.org. Because DMOZ is a human-edited directory, other search engines (like Google) weigh links on this site very heavily.
  4. Link and Be Linked - network with partner websites and share links with sites of similar content. This strengthens the context of your website's context, fosters more paths to your site, and ultimately leads to better rankings.
  5. Get Creative! - brainstorm ways that you can provide free services on your website. Or offer special promotions, and pass this highly valuable information on to other sites in your network. Your affiliates will love to have "the inside scoop" on your latest promotion, and can help drive traffic to your site. This additional links result in added visibility and a higher chance for success!
